Overview:

Manufacturing Labourers are responsible for performing a variety of tasks in a manufacturing setting. They may be involved in assembly, packaging, and other production-related activities. They must be able to follow instructions, work quickly and accurately, and maintain a safe work environment.

How To Become an Manufacturing Labourer:

To become a Manufacturing Labourer, you will need to have a high school diploma or equivalent. You may also need to complete on-the-job training and/or a certification program.
